Florala Municipal Airport is a city-owned public-use airport located three nautical miles northeast of the central business district of Florala, a city in Covington County, Alabama, United States.

Florala
Village
Florala is a town in Covington County, Alabama, United States. At the 2020 census, the population was 1,923.

Lockhart is a town in Covington County, Alabama, United States. At the 2020 census, the population was 445. Lockhart is situated 2 miles west of Town of Florala.
